How to add this emoji
Add to Discord
- Click Download PNG above to save the emoji_112 image.
- Open Discord and go to Server Settings → Emoji.
- Click Upload Emoji and choose the downloaded file.
- Give it a name and save. You need the Manage Emojis and Stickers permission.
Add to Slack
- Download the emoji_112 image.
- Open the Slack emoji picker and click Add Emoji.
- Upload the file, name it, and save.
